Raflan

Sardar Khehra
December 30, 2023
Popularity
Number of Tracks
1
Label
OGHOOD RECORDS
Copyright
2023 OGHOOD RECORDS
UPC
859781623171
#TrackArtistKeyCamelotBPM
1Raflan by Sardar KhehraRaflanSardar KhehraD Major10B99